The House will know that His Majesty's
Government have already decided to re-inforce
the garrison in Hong Kong in view of the
uncertain position in China and our
responsibility for Hong Kong and the welfare
of its people. His Majesty's Government.
have found it necessary to send some
additional re-inforcements and the necessary
steps in the matter are being taken by all
three Services,
H.M. Government have furthermore decided
to appoint a Commander, British Force8,
Hong Kong, to be in command of all the Army,
Air and such Naval units as are assigned from
time to time for the defence of Hong Kong.
They have appointed to this post, Lieutenant
General F.W. Festing, and he will also act
as General Officer, Commanding-in-Chief, Land
Forces. General Festing will leave very
shortly and will take up his duties
immediately upon his arrival in Hong Kong.
H.M. Government in the United Kingdom
have kept the Governments of the other
Commonwealth countries fully informed at all
stages both of the policy being followed and
the measures being taken to implement it.
We have also been in touch with the Government
of the United States of America.
